The Seraphín chandelier by Spark & Bell represented a compelling fusion of sustainable design and artistic craftsmanship. The piece debuted at Material Matters Copenhagen during the 3daysofdesign 2025 festival.
This multi-tiered lighting fixture stood out for its innovative use of recycled materials. Spark & Bell used proprietary Jewel plastic — a material made with discarded CD cases — which was transformed into crystalline droplets that diffuse light with an ethereal glow. The piece’s cascading, light-diffusing forms created a mesmerizing visual effect that would make a statement in both residential and commercial spaces.
Handcrafted in the brand’s Brighton workshop, the chandelier embodies Spark & Bell’s commitment to circular design. It is complete with modular components and a lifetime repair service, backed by an industry-leading 10-year warranty.
